Who Will Replace Alex Mercer?

According to leaked information, it is said that the new Prototype game may not feature the iconic protagonist of the series, Alex Mercer. Instead, it is among the claims that a completely different storyline and a brand new character may come to the fore. This situation signals that the new game may go in a different direction narratively from the previous productions of the series. However, the cornerstones of the Prototype universe, such as the wide and open world structure that offers free exploration, unique biological powers and destructive action mechanics interacting with the environment, are expected to be preserved. How was the Prototype Legend Born?

The Prototype series first met with gamers in 2009 and quickly gained great acclaim for its extraordinary gameplay mechanics. The game, which allowed players to roam freely in the vast open world of New York City, run acrobatically on the walls of buildings, and use powerful and destructive biological transformation abilities to defeat their enemies, brought a new breath to the genre. The series' success was cemented with the second game released in 2012, and Prototype gained a loyal player base. However, the series, which fell silent from the mid-2010s, had not been on the agenda with any new content or game announcements for a long time.
